      <description>Title: Factors Affecting The Members Participation On Cooperative In North Sumatera
Authors: Ernita; Firmansyah; Rozi, Agus Al
Abstract: This research discuss about a variety of factors that might affect increased participation of members in cooperative. As the owners and users,&#xD;
the role of a member is decisive importance in business development of cooperatives. The importance of improving the participation of members as a&#xD;
solution in improving the performance of cooperatives, which is still low so far is need to be explored. The study was held in several municipalities and&#xD;
regencies in North Sumatera, by involving a hundred respondents. First, tested reliability and validity of an instrument, next test the assumption classical,&#xD;
includes of normality, multicollinearity, and heteroscedasticity. Next, the data is analyzed using Pearson correlation test and multiple linear regressions.&#xD;
The results showed that there is a significant correlation between all the independent variables with the participation of member, with the respective&#xD;
correlation level of r1 = 0.509, r2 = 0.672, r3 = 0.606, r4 = 0.713, r5 = 0.626, r6 = 0.709, and r7 = 0.660. The regression equation model is obtained as&#xD;
follows: Y = 0.859 + 0.089 X1 +0.122 X2 + 0.060 X3 + 0.199 X4 +0.138 X5 +0.096 X6 + 0.097 X7, and coefficient determinant R2 = 0.749. The research&#xD;
get a concept model for development participation members, where the factor is significantly affected by service quality (X4), motivation non material&#xD;
(X1), infrastructure (X5), motivation material (X2), management capability of the Board (X6), and education and training (X7), while perception member&#xD;
(X3) is not significant effected. This research concluded that the participation of the members of the cooperative can be enhanced by improving the&#xD;
quality of service to members, involve members in various activities, providing adequate facilities and infrastructure and enhance the capabilities of&#xD;
Board in managing, as well as provide a useful education and training.</description>

      <description>Title: Effect of manager entrepreneurship attitude and member motivation on organizational member participation
Authors: Ernita; Firmansyah; Martial, Tri
Abstract: The purpose of this study is to know the effect of entrepreneurship attitude of manager and cooperative member motivation in enhancing member participation in North Sumatera Province, Indonesia. A questionnaire survey with a 1-5 Likert Scale is executed to achieve the objective of the&#xD;
study. Respondents consist of 100 managers and 100 members of the cooperatives. Data is analyzed&#xD;
using SPSS v. 20. The results show that manager entrepreneurship attitude and member motivations&#xD;
correlated significantly in increasing the participation of cooperative members with r1 = 0.866 (pvalue=0.00) and r2 = 0.902 (p-value=0.00), respectively. Likewise, entrepreneurship attitude of&#xD;
manager and member motivation have significant effects on increasing member participation. It is&#xD;
also found that R2 = 0.836, and F-value was 247,430 with α&lt;0.01. This study revealed the independent variable significantly correlated and increased participation of member in the Province of&#xD;
North Sumatera, Indonesia. Thus, it is very important to insert entrepreneurship attitude and motivation in providing cooperative education.</description>

      <description>Title: Performance Measurement Using Balanced Scorecard Concept On Co-Operatives: Implication In Indonesia
Authors: Ernita; Firmansyah
Abstract: This study aims to apply the concept of balanced scorecards in measurement of co-operatives performance based on vision and mission. So&#xD;
far, the assessment of co-operative performance in Indonesia is not take into account the social hold co-operative, while co-operatives carrying a dual&#xD;
mission. Research conducted in in North Sumatera Province in Indonesia. The sample consisting of one hundred co-operatives that are still active run&#xD;
annual members meeting. Co-operative performance was assessed based on its fourth perspective i.e. membership, financial, internal process and&#xD;
learning &amp; growth. The indicator key of cooperative performance was determined by taking into account the performance assessment on co-operatives,&#xD;
as articulated of State Minister for Co-operatives and SMEs No.129/KEP/M/KUMKM/XI/2002, and the regulations of the State Minister for Co-operatives&#xD;
and SME No.06/Per/M./KUKM/V/2006. Therefore, this research were contributed a method in assessing co-operative performance using Balanced&#xD;
Scorecard concept with the four perspective, namely membership perspective, financial perspective, internal process perspective and learning &amp; growth&#xD;
perspective.</description>
